Clinical, epidemiological, and laboratory characteristics of the AD group
| Subjects with AD (n = 106) | |
|---|---|
| Age (years) | 8.2 ± 4.0 |
| Gender | |
| Male | 38 (35.85%) |
| Female | 68 (64.15%) |
| Fitzpatrick skin type | |
| II | 7 (6.60%) |
| III | 30 (28.30%) |
| IV | 65 (61.32%) |
| V | 4 (37.78%) |
| BMI (kg/m2) | 17.8 ± 3.7 |
| Asthma or AR | |
| Yes | 60 (56.60%) |
| No | 46 (43.40%) |
| Familial history of atopy | |
| Yes | 72 (67.92%) |
| No | 34 (32.08%) |
| Age of onset (years) | 2.1 ± 2.8 |
| SCORAD index | 28.3 ± 15.3 |
| Mild AD | 49 (46.23%) |
| Moderate AD | 48 (45.28%) |
| Severe AD | 9 (8.49%) |
| 25(OH)D (ng/ml) | 29.0 ± 9.7 |
| Sufficiency | 45 (42.45%) |
| Insufficiency | 44 (41.51%) |
| Deficiency | 17 (16.04%) |
| Total IgE (IU/ml) | 1242.8 ± 2297.7 |
| Eosinophils (%) | 7.7% ± 5.0 |
| UVI (mean of 30 days) | 11.65 ± 2.81 |
Values expressed as mean ± standard deviation or n (%)

Epidemiological and laboratory characteristics of AD subgroup and control group
| AD subgroup (n = 54) | Control group (n = 54) | |
|---|---|---|
| Age (years) | 9.1 ± 4.1 | 9.0 ± 4.3 |
| Gender | ||
| Male | 22 (40.74%) | 22 (40.74%) |
| Female | 32 (59.26%) | 32 (59.26%) |
| Fitzpatrick skin type | ||
| II | 1 (1.85%) | 5 (9.26%) |
| III | 17 (31.48%) | 9 (16.67%) |
| IV | 35 (64.82%) | 39 (72.22%) |
| V | 1 (1.85%) | 1 (1.85%) |
| BMI (kg/m2) | 17.7 ± 2.6 | 17.8 ± 2.5 |
| 25(OH)D (ng/ml) | 29.0 ± 8.8 | 25.6 ± 7 |
| Sufficiency | 23 (42.59%) | 12 (22.22%) |
| Insufficiency | 21 (38.89%) | 33 (61.11%) |
| Deficiency | 10 (18.52%) | 9 (16.67%) |
| UVI (mean of 30 days) | 12.85 ± 2.09 | 10.31 ± 2.54 |
Values expressed as mean ± standard deviation or n (%)
